We have our own business and I wonder if there are any issues using your personal credit card for business purposes. I don’t do it regularly, but for some large expenses, it makes sense to use the credit card to get rewards, then to reimburse myself from the company business account.
Is there any major issue with this?

In terms of accounting/tax I think you can use whatever account/card you like for expenses, but it may make your record-keeping more complex if personal and business expenses are both coming from the same account.
The only issue may be with the points. If it’s a personal credit card, the T&Cs might have something against earning points on business expenses. I don’t know the answer but that’s something you could look for.
